Understanding Blackjack Rules and Objectives
At its core, blackjack is a deceptively simple card game where players compete against the dealer rather than each other. The primary objective is to achieve a helping hand value closer to 21 than the dealer’s hand without exceeding 21, which results in a bout. Cards are valued as follows: number cards hold their face value, face cards (Jack, Queen, Martin luther king) are worth 10, and an Ace can be counted as either 1 or 11, depending on which benefits the helping hand most. A hand with an Ace counted as 11 is termed a ‘soft’ hand, offering flexibility without the immediate peril of busting. The game begins with each user receiving two cards, typically both face up, while the dealer receives one card face up and one face down (the hole card). Players then determine whether to ‘hit’ (take another card) or ‘stand’ (keep their current hand). Additional options include ‘double down’ (doubling the initial gamble in exchange for one additional card), ‘split’ (if the first two cards are of touch value, they can be stock split into two separate hands, each with a bet equal to the original), and ‘surrender’ (forfeiting half the wager to end the paw). The dealer must come to on 16 or less and stand on 17 or more, though specific rules vary by variant. Understanding these fundamental rules is the first of all step to mastering the offering and recognising the subtle strategic nuances that separate casual players from skilled ones.

Mastering Basic Strategy and Reducing the House Edge
Basic strategy is a mathematically derived set of decisions that minimises the house edge to its lowest possible level, typically around 0.5% to 1% depending on the specific rules. This strategy dictates the optimal play for every possible combination of player deal and dealer upcard, covering when to run into, stand, double down, split, or deliver. For example, with a severe 16 against a dealer’s 10, canonical strategy recommends surrendering if allowed, otherwise hitting; while with a diffuse 18 against a dealer’s 6, standing is optimal. The strategy is based on millions of simulations and accounts for the composition of the remaining deck, though it assumes a full deck distribution. Memorising a basic strategy chart is essential for any serious player, as fifty-fifty small deviations can increase the house sharpness significantly. For instance, standing on 12 against a dealer’s 2 instead of hitting reduces the house border by about 0.2%. Beyond staple strategy, card counting can further tilt the odds in the player’s favour by tracking the ratio of high to low cards remaining, but this is often discouraged by casinos and may be impractical in online live dealer games due to continuous shuffling machines. In the UK, where multiple decks are common, staple strategy remains the most accessible and effective tool for casual players. By consistently applying canonical strategy, players can try blackjack with a domiciliate edge corresponding to or improve than many other casino games, making it unity of the most player-friendly options on the floor.

What is the house edge in blackjack and how does it vary by rules?
The domiciliate edge in blackjack typically ranges from 0.5% to 2% depending on the specific rules, such as the list of decks, whether the dealer hits on soft 17, and the payout for blackjack. Standard single-deck games with favourable rules can have an edge as low as 0.13% with perfect staple strategy.
How does basic strategy work and is it always effectual?
Basic strategy is a mathematically optimised set of decisions for every possible hand combination, designed to minimise the domiciliate edge. While it doesn’t guarantee wins, it reduces the edge to its lowest possible level and is essential for long-term play.
What are the florida key differences between online and live dealer blackjack?
Online blackjack uses a random figure source (RNG) for virtual cards, offering faster play and depress minimum bets, while live dealer blackjack streams a real human dealer from a studio, providing an authentic casino atmosphere with real cards and interaction.
Is card counting possible in online or live blackjack?
Card counting is ineffective in online RNG blackjack because the deck is reshuffled after each hand. In live dealer games, continuous shuffle machines (CSMs) are commonly used, making counting impractical, though manual shuffles on some tables may allow it.
